New to Driving in Ireland? Your Guide to Getting a Licence

So, you're considering to acquire your driving copyright in Ireland? It can seem a somewhat daunting, but this easy guide will walk you through the steps . Initially, you’ll need to finish the Learner Theory Test, which examines Irish road rules and safety points. Following that, you'll be eligible for driving lessons with an approved driving instructor . Remember, you must display ‘L’ plates or a ‘D’ sticker while learning . After sufficient training, you can schedule your practical driving assessment with the National Driver Licence Service (NDLS). Be ready to display safe and careful driving techniques. Good luck !
